MI Cape Town (MICT) will lock horns against the Joburg Super Kings (JSK) in the 15th match of SA20 2025/26. The game will be played at Newlands Stadium in Cape Town on 6th January 2026 at 9 PM IST.
MI Cape Town is the only side yet to register their first win this season. The defending champions are at the bottom of the table with four defeats and one washed-out game. Their middle order has been abysmal, and it’s the main reason for their poor performance.
They were bundled out for just 88 runs in their last game. Ryan Rickelton is doing all the work with the bat. The likes of Nicholas Pooran, Rassie van der Dussen, Jason Smith, and others need to take responsibility too.
Bowling-wise, the lack of wickets from Trent Boult, Corbin Bosch, and even Rashid Khan has hurt the side. Overall, MI will have to perform as a team if they are to register their first win.
The Joburg Super Kings, on the other hand, are second in the points table with three wins and a washed-out game. They defeated the Durban Super Giants in a super over thriller in their last game. Contrary to MI, JSK has been playing as a team with all the players contributing.
Despite that, they still need consistency from the middle order and bowlers as well. JSK will be eyeing their fourth win of the tournament.

Newlands Cape Town Pitch Report and Weather
We saw MI getting bowled out for just 88 runs in the last game played here. There was good assistance for the spinners, and the pacers also got some help with the new ball. But overall, the wicket is expected to be batting friendly. The average first innings score here in 2025 was 179 runs in T20s.
Scores in the range of 160-180 are expected, and teams should prefer chasing. Light rain is expected at the start of the game, so we may see a rain-interrupted game.
